Jane LEONARD was born 5 November 1714 in Preston, Crown Colony of Connecticut

Jane LEONARD was the child of Samuel LEONARD (LEONARDSON)   and   Lydia COOKE and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Samuel LEONARD (LEONARDSON) and Abigail ATWOOD (WOOD) (maternal)  Richard COOKE and Grace LARABEE?

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Jane  married  Daniel WILLIAMS 6 June 1737 in Preston, Crown Colony of Connecticut .  The couple had (at least) 6 children.
Daniel WILLIAMS  was born 28 April 1709 in Preston, Connecticut, USA (Poquetanuck).  Daniel died 4 March 1764 in Canterbury, Connecticut, USA.  Daniel was the child of Nicholas WILLIAMS and Dorcas DAVISON.

Jane LEONARD died April 1753 in Preston, Crown Colony of Connecticut .
